Ghana joins four other African countries to qualify for 2026 World Cup

Ghana joined the other African countries that booked their spot at the 2026 World Cup.

This follows a shaky one-goal victory against Comoros at the Accra Sports Stadium on Sunday, October 12.

The victory means the Black Stars top Group I with 25 points, 6 points ahead of Madagascar, while Mali finished third.

As has become the norm, Tottenham Hotspur winger, Mohammed Kudus, scored the decisive goal in the second half of the match.

They will now be making their fifth appearance at the World Cup, after featuring in the 2006, 2010, 2014 and 2022 editions.

Other African nations that have qualified for the 2026 edition include Egypt, Tunisia, Morocco and Algeria.

Qualification for the expanded 48-nation 2026 tournament, which the United States, Canada and Mexico will co-host, justified the faith of Ghanaian officials in coach Otto Addo, who was under fire last year.
